See LICENSE.TXT for details. +// +//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===// + +namespace lldb { + + +class SBPlatformConnectOptions +{ +public: + SBPlatformConnectOptions (const char *url); + + SBPlatformConnectOptions (const SBPlatformConnectOptions &rhs); + + ~SBPlatformConnectOptions (); + + const char * + GetURL(); + + void + SetURL(const char *url); + + bool + GetRsyncEnabled(); + + void + EnableRsync (const char *options, + const char *remote_path_prefix, + bool omit_remote_hostname); + + void + DisableRsync (); + + const char * + GetLocalCacheDirectory(); + + void + SetLocalCacheDirectory(const char *path); +}; + +class SBPlatformShellCommand +{ +public: + SBPlatformShellCommand (const char *shell_command); + + SBPlatformShellCommand (const SBPlatformShellCommand &rhs); + + ~SBPlatformShellCommand(); + + void + Clear(); + + const char * + GetCommand(); + + void + SetCommand(const char *shell_command); + + const char * + GetWorkingDirectory (); + + void + SetWorkingDirectory (const char *path); + + uint32_t + GetTimeoutSeconds (); + + void + SetTimeoutSeconds (uint32_t sec); + + int + GetSignal (); + + int + GetStatus (); + + const char * + GetOutput (); +}; + +%feature("docstring", +"A class that represents a platform that can represent the current host or a remote host debug platform. + +The SBPlatform class represents the current host, or a remote host. +It can be connected to a remote platform in order to provide ways +to remotely launch and attach to processes, upload/download files, +create directories, run remote shell commands, find locally cached +versions of files from the remote system, and much more. + +SBPlatform objects can be created and then used to connect to a remote +platform which allows the SBPlatform to be used to get a list of the +current processes on the remote host, attach to one of those processes, +install programs on the remote system, attach and launch processes, +and much more. + +Every SBTarget has a corresponding SBPlatform. The platform can be +specified upon target creation, or the currently selected platform +will attempt to be used when creating the target automatically as long +as the currently selected platform matches the target architecture +and executable type. If the architecture or executable type do not match, +a suitable platform will be found automatically." + +) SBPlatform; +class SBPlatform +{ +public: + + SBPlatform (); + + SBPlatform (const char *); + + ~SBPlatform(); + + bool + IsValid () const; + + void + Clear (); + + const char * + GetWorkingDirectory(); + + bool + SetWorkingDirectory(const char *); + + const char * + GetName (); + + SBError + ConnectRemote (lldb::SBPlatformConnectOptions &connect_options); + + void + DisconnectRemote (); + + bool + IsConnected(); + + const char * + GetTriple(); + + const char * + GetHostname (); + + const char * + GetOSBuild (); + + const char * + GetOSDescription (); + + uint32_t + GetOSMajorVersion (); + + uint32_t + GetOSMinorVersion (); + + uint32_t + GetOSUpdateVersion (); + + lldb::SBError + Get (lldb::SBFileSpec &src, lldb::SBFileSpec &dst); + + lldb::SBError + Put (lldb::SBFileSpec &src, lldb::SBFileSpec &dst); + + lldb::SBError + Install (lldb::SBFileSpec &src, lldb::SBFileSpec &dst); + + lldb::SBError + Run (lldb::SBPlatformShellCommand &shell_command); + + lldb::SBError + Launch (lldb::SBLaunchInfo &launch_info); + + lldb::SBError + Kill (const lldb::pid_t pid); + + lldb::SBError + MakeDirectory (const char *path, uint32_t file_permissions = lldb::eFilePermissionsDirectoryDefault); + + uint32_t + GetFilePermissions (const char *path); + + lldb::SBError + SetFilePermissions (const char *path, uint32_t file_permissions); + + lldb::SBUnixSignals + GetUnixSignals(); + +}; + +} // namespace lldb |
